Chapter 61: Kitchen Utensils

The official list of the committee's five members has been confirmed:

Dong Junwei, Tang Jing, Chen Mu, Wei Dalei, He Ying.

As for the responsibilities and daily work, Tang Jing promised to present a plan within twenty-four hours for everyone to discuss and vote on.

Initially, the entire meeting was approached with a lighthearted attitude. No one even thought it would be a formal meeting at first; they merely stood in a circle on an open ground, and later moved to sit on towels as time went on.

From establishing the organizational name to electing the leadership committee, the mood gradually became more serious.

Time passed, and it was well into lunchtime before they realized they hadn't eaten yet.

"I'll go prepare something right away," Du Jiajia quickly stood up.

The current food was still just pancakes made from flour. Although Du Jiajia had been continuously improving and innovating, they had only that much to work with. It's challenging to come up with varied dishes with limited resources, and it's easy to get tired of the same food.

Fortunately, compared to the previous plain rice cakes, the pancakes now had oil and salt, which made them much better, though it would still take some time before people grew tired of them.

The celery leaves they brought back had become the main food these days. Fresh vegetables couldn't be stored for long, so everyone devoured them with great gusto.

For He Ying and the others, especially Feng Xiaoyu, who had just arrived, this meal was a revelation.

The steaming hot pancakes had fresh vegetables, meat, and even a spicy sauce.

When was the last time they had experienced such a life?

As Feng Xiaoyu took a bite of the scalding pancake, tears couldn't help but stream down her face. He Ying patted her shoulder, understanding her emotions.

The kitchen facilities were getting more and more complete now. Dong Junwei used heated iron blocks as stoves, and they went through several transformations until they reached the height and shape that Du Jiajia was satisfied with.

Various kitchen utensils were also added one by one under Chef Du's demands.

From the simplest iron plates to knives, spatulas, and various plates for serving food, even steel wire balls and rags for cleaning were all available.

The steel wire balls took a lot of effort to make.

Slowly pulling stainless steel into evenly thick iron wires, then forming them into balls, this seemingly simple task took Chen Mu nearly two hours, nearly exhausting him mentally.

However, the resulting steel wire balls were incomparable in both texture and practicality to store-bought ones.

As for the rag, Chen Mu simply gave up.

He just tore some cotton threads from a towel, wrapped them together, and made do with it.

Of course, most of the time, the tableware was just wiped clean, as water was still too precious.

"Do you have any suggestions?" Tang Jing asked.

"I have two options. The first is to completely block it, leaving no gaps. The advantage of this approach is that we won't have to worry about small crawlers getting in. The second is to use a fence. I can use iron bars to stand under the gap, one end inserted into the cement floor and the other buried into the bottom edge of the door. The advantage of this is better ventilation."

"Ventilation?" He Ying couldn't help but ask.

"Ventilation is indeed a problem. It's not yet the hottest time, but when it comes to July and August, without a ceiling in this storage room, the daytime temperature will become terrifying. Our perception of the outside temperature doesn't seem to have changed much after shrinking, which is unreasonable. Logically, our body's heat dissipation..."

Tang Jing paused and then smiled, "Let's not dwell on that. In short, it's better not to completely block the gaps in the door. Although this storage room is large enough for us, we can't be sure if the internal air circulation here would serve as a ventilation system."

"So, we'll tentatively use the fence plan?" Dong Junwei proposed.

"Agreed," Chen Mu nodded.

"Also, we need to think about water."

"Drinking water is not a problem for now, but we should consider bathing, washing dishes, and flushing the toilet in the morning and evening."

As soon as Chen Mu finished speaking, everyone heard a sound like something striking the glass window of the storage room.

They were startled.

The sound occurred again a few seconds later.

Everyone looked up.

They noticed that the previously clear glass seemed to have two blurred spots.

Clearly.

They were water droplets.

"Is it raining?"
